Nature’s Wisdom: Finding Peace and Purpose for Men in Midlife

In today’s fast-paced world, many men in their 40s to 60s find themselves yearning for peace, clarity, and a more profound sense of purpose. Nature offers a sanctuary, a place to escape the noise and reconnect with your spiritual essence. Spending intentional time outdoors can cultivate grounding, reflection, and a renewed connection with life’s rhythms.

Finding Peace in the Outdoors

The natural world invites you to slow down and be present. A walk through a quiet forest, standing by a serene lake, or simply sitting in your garden or local park can have a profound calming effect. In these moments, you’re reminded that life operates in cycles, just as the seasons shift and the sun rises and sets. These patterns offer comfort and perspective, grounding you in the understanding that life’s challenges are temporary and part of a greater flow.

Nature as a Mirror

Nature often reflects your inner journey. The resilience of a tree enduring storms can inspire strength. The vastness of a clear sky can evoke a sense of freedom and possibility. When you spend time outdoors, allow these elements to speak to you. What lessons do they hold for your current stage in life? Reflection in natural spaces can lead to clarity and a deeper understanding of your purpose.

Simple Practices to Deepen Connection

Engaging in small, meaningful rituals can transform your time outdoors into a spiritual practice. Here are a few ideas:

  • Mindful Walking: As you walk, pay attention to the sounds, sights, and textures around you. This practice can ground you in the present moment.
  • Journaling: Bring a notebook and jot down your thoughts and feelings. Write about what you observe in nature and how it relates to your life.
  • Gratitude Rituals: Offer a token of gratitude to the earth, such as leaving a stone or flower as a symbol of appreciation for its gifts.
Making Time for Nature

Reconnecting with nature doesn’t require grand adventures. A local park, your garden, or even a small green space can become a haven for reflection and connection. The key is to make your time outdoors intentional and free of distractions.
